5) (10 pts) John is baby-sitting Casey, his 3-year old brother. He puts a crash helmet on Casey, places him in the red wagon and takes him on a stroll through the neighborhood. As John starts across the street, he exerts a 58 N forward force on the wagon. There is a 20 N resistance force (friction) and the wagon and Casey have a combined weight of 302 N. Construct a free body diagram showing all the forces acting upon the wagon.
